What can I see and do near University of London?
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at The British Museum, National Portrait Gallery or National Gallery. Explore landmarks like Big Ben, Buckingham Palace and Tower of London. You can check out the local talent at Dominion Theatre, Shaftesbury Theatre and Phoenix Theatre.
